Bungalows for Sale in Birchcliffe-Cliffside
Birchcliffe-Cliffside Bungalows & One-Storey Homes
This page shows bungalows for sale in Birchcliffe-Cliffside, ranging from original post-war brick homes to fully renovated luxury properties. These single-story homes are highly sought after by downsizers looking for accessibility and families seeking detached living with substantial outdoor space.
Birchcliffe-Cliffside is known as the "Garden Neighbourhood" of Scarborough, featuring winding tree-lined streets and some of the largest lots in the city (often 150-feet deep). Unlike the cramped grid of downtown, bungalows here typically offer private driveways, garages, and excellent potential for garden suites or second-story additions near the Bluffs.

Buying a Bungalow in Birchcliffe-Cliffside
Bungalows are the predominant housing style in Birchcliffe-Cliffside, particularly south of Kingston Road. They offer a unique value proposition for buyers who want land ownership without the premium price tag of The Beaches.
Birchcliffe Bungalows vs. The Beaches Semis
Buyers often debate between a detached bungalow here or a semi-detached home further west. Here is the comparison:
| Feature | Birchcliffe Bungalow | The Beaches Semi |
|---|---|---|
| Lot Size | 40ft x 120ft+ (Typical) | 20ft x 100ft (Typical) |
| Privacy | Detached (No shared walls) | Attached neighbors |
| Parking | Private Driveway / Garage | Street Parking / Mutual Drive |
| Expansion Potential | High (Top-up or Garden Suite) | Low (Heritage restrictions) |
Frequently Asked Questions
1. Why are bungalows so popular in Birchcliffe-Cliffside?
They offer the perfect entry point into detached ownership. The large lots provide immense future value, allowing owners to renovate, build a rear addition, or add a second story as their family grows.
2. Do these bungalows have separate entrances?
Yes. A significant majority of the 1940s and 1950s bungalows in this area were built with a side door leading directly to the basement stairs. This makes them ideal for creating in-law suites or income units.
3. Are there raised bungalows available?
Yes, particularly in the Cliffside area (east of Birchmount). Raised bungalows are excellent for basement apartments because they feature larger, above-grade windows that let in plenty of natural light.
4. Can I build a garden suite on these lots?
In many cases, yes. Birchcliffe is famous for its deep lots (often 150ft deep). Under Toronto's new zoning bylaws, many of these properties qualify for a detached Garden Suite, which is perfect for multi-generational living.
5. What is the difference between a "wartime" bungalow and a custom build?
Wartime bungalows are smaller (approx. 800-1000 sq ft) homes built in the 1940s. Custom builds are often these same homes that have been topped up or fully rebuilt into large 2-storey estates, which is a common trend on streets like Fallingbrook and Chine Drive.
6. Is this area good for downsizers?
Absolutely. It is one of the few neighbourhoods in Toronto where you can find a manageable, single-level home that still offers a garden and privacy, without moving to a condo.
7. How close are the schools?
Most bungalows in the area are within walking distance of highly-rated schools like Birch Cliff Public School. The neighbourhood was designed to be walkable, with schools often located in the center of the residential pockets.
8. Are these homes freehold or condo?
Almost all bungalows in Birchcliffe-Cliffside are freehold, meaning you own the land and the building with no monthly maintenance fees.
